Disclosed is a three-dimensional shape measuring device for obtaining pattern images with high accuracy. The three-dimensional shape measuring device can increase the accuracy when the height of a measured object according to positions is calculated from the pattern images, obtained by an image obtaining part, by generating grid-patterned light with which the measured object is irradiated close to sine waves using a grid unit in which multiple reversible saw-shaped unit grids are arranged at predetermined intervals in parallel. The present invention facilitates assembly and reduces manufacturing costs because an astigmatic lens is not necessary by forming the distance between a second angular point of a unit cell and a second angular point of the next unit cell greater than 0, but smaller than the limit of resolution which is the minimum distance to enable a condensing lens to distinguish two objects
